General annotation (Comments)

Function

Catalyzes the conversion of D-ribulose 5-phosphate to formate and 3,4-dihydroxy-2-butanone 4-phosphate By similarity. HAMAP MF_01283

Catalyzes the conversion of GTP to 2,5-diamino-6-ribosylamino-4(3H)-pyrimidinone 5'-phosphate (DARP), formate and pyrophosphate By similarity. HAMAP MF_01283

Catalytic activity

D-ribulose 5-phosphate = formate + L-3,4-dihydroxybutan-2-one 4-phosphate. HAMAP MF_01283

GTP + 3 H2O = formate + 2,5-diamino-6-hydroxy-4-(5-phospho-D-ribosylamino)pyrimidine + diphosphate. HAMAP MF_01283

Cofactor

Binds 2 divalent metal cations per subunit. Magnesium or manganese By similarity.

Binds 1 zinc ion per subunit By similarity. HAMAP MF_01283

Pathway

Cofactor biosynthesis; riboflavin biosynthesis; 2-hydroxy-3-oxobutyl phosphate from D-ribulose 5-phosphate: step 1/1. HAMAP MF_01283

Cofactor biosynthesis; riboflavin biosynthesis; 5-amino-6-(D-ribitylamino)uracil from GTP: step 1/4. HAMAP MF_01283

Sequence similarities

In the N-terminal section; belongs to the DHBP synthase family.

In the C-terminal section; belongs to the GTP cyclohydrolase II family.
